Air travel these days is unpleasant enough, but getting charged a surprise airline fee is sure to make passengers even grumpier.
Here are a few fees you may encounter and ways to avoid or limit them.
Airline Baggage Fees
Typical amount: $30 to $35 for the first checked bag and $40 to $45 for the second on major U.S. airlines
Southwest Airlines charges no fee for the first or second checked bag of standard weight. If you regularly fly with another airline, look at its credit card selection. The Citi/AAdvantage Platinum Select Mastercard from American Airlines ($99 annual fee, waived the first year), Delta SkyMiles Gold American Express ($99, waived the first year) and United Explorer Visa ($95, waived the first year) allow the cardholder and at least one traveling companion to check the first bag free on their respective airlines….
